Pro Tips

To get the absolute best out of this salad, always undercook your pasta by about a minute from the package directions – it’ll firm up beautifully as it chills and prevent any mushiness. Don’t be afraid to really season your dressing; a little extra black pepper or a squeeze of lemon can make all the difference in highlighting the creamy avocado in this Avocado Caesar Pasta Salad. And always, always chill it for at least an hour before serving; the flavors meld and deepen so wonderfully.

My Secret Trick: I love to gently mash about a quarter of the avocado directly into the Caesar dressing before adding it to the pasta; it creates an even smoother, richer consistency that’s just divine.

How to Store Avocado Caesar Pasta Salad

  • For optimal freshness, store your Avocado Caesar Pasta Salad in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2-3 days.
  • Unfortunately, due to the avocado, this salad does not freeze well, as the texture and color will degrade upon thawing.
  • If you plan for meal prep, consider adding a fresh squeeze of lemon juice before storing to help minimize avocado browning.
  • Enjoy it straight from the fridge; no reheating is necessary as it’s meant to be served cold.

FAQs

Can I make this Avocado Caesar Pasta Salad ahead of time?

You absolutely can, but I recommend preparing it no more than a day in advance due to the avocado browning. A fresh squeeze of lemon juice over the avocado before mixing helps a lot!

What kind of pasta works best for this recipe?

I find that medium-sized pasta shapes like rotini, fusilli, or penne work wonderfully because they have nooks and crannies to capture all that creamy dressing. Using a protein pasta also enhances its heartiness.

Can I add protein to this pasta salad?

Oh yes, that’s a fantastic idea! I often toss in grilled chicken, crispy bacon, or even some chickpeas for an extra boost. It makes it an even more satisfying lunch option.

How do I prevent the avocado from browning?

Beyond the lemon juice trick, ensuring the salad is tightly covered and minimizing air exposure will help. If you’re truly concerned, you can add the avocado right before serving to maintain its freshest color and texture.

Avocado Caesar Pasta Salad

This creamy, tangy, and refreshing pasta salad combines the best of Caesar with the richness of avocado for a perfect potluck or weeknight meal.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Main Dish, Salad, Side Dish
Cuisine: American
Calories: 720

Ingredients
  

For the Pasta
  • 12 oz rotini pasta or other short pasta like fusilli or farfalle
  • 1 tsp salt for pasta water
For the Creamy Avocado Caesar Dressing
  • 1.5 large ripe avocado peeled and pitted
  • 0.5 cup mayonnaise good quality
  • 2 tbsp freshly squeezed lemon juice
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 0.5 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 tsp Dijon mustard
  • 0.5 tsp Worcestershire sauce
  • 0.5 tsp salt or to taste
  • 0.25 tsp black pepper freshly ground, or to taste
For Assembly
  • 1 head romaine lettuce chopped
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es halved
  • 0.5 large ripe avocado diced, for mixing in
  • 1 cup croutons
  • grated Parmesan cheese for garnish

Equipment

  • Large pot
  • Colander
  • Food Processor
  • Large mixing bowl
  • Measuring Cups and Spoons

Method
 

Cook the Pasta
  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a rolling boil. Add the rotini pasta and cook according to package directions until al dente, usually 8-10 minutes. Once cooked, drain the pasta in a colander and rinse with cold water to stop the cooking and cool it down. Set aside.
Prepare the Dressing
  • While the pasta cools, prepare the avocado Caesar dressing. In a food processor, combine the 1.5 ripe avocados, mayonnaise, lemon juice, minced garlic, 0.5 cup Parmesan cheese, Dijon mustard, Worcestershire sauce, 0.5 tsp salt, and 0.25 tsp black pepper. Process until completely smooth and creamy, scraping down the sides as needed. Taste and adjust seasonings if necessary.
Assemble the Salad
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ooled pasta, chopped romaine lettuce, halved cherry tomatoes, and the 0.5 diced avocado.
  • Pour the creamy avocado Caesar dressing over the pasta and vegetables. Toss gently until everything is well coated. You want every nook and cranny to get some of that delicious dressing!
  • Just before serving, fold in the croutons. Garnish with additional grated Parmesan cheese if you like. Serve immediately and enjoy!

Notes

Make it a heartier meal by adding 2 cups of shredded rotisserie chicken or grilled shrimp. For a vegetarian protein boost, stir in a can of drained and rinsed chickpeas. If you're making this ahead, keep the dressing separate and toss it with the pasta and veggies right before serving to prevent the lettuce from wilting and the avocado from browning. Feel free to customize with other veggies like cucumber, red onion, or bell peppers.
